The interior wire harness looks tough but was easer then I thought. All I did was pull the bulb plugs off and fed the harness through the big hole on the passenger side and the fuel latch wire or wheat ever that thing is called I disconnected that and ran it through the driver side hole. That's the positive part the negative part was that I had to cut the radio wire, when I did that I accidentally cut the wire that locks the rear hatch. It can be done manually but FYI and I deleted the rear wiper so the washer hose I just pulled out and plugged the hole on the hatch. The evap system in the engine was easy I just went to vato zone and bought hoses in the same size as the hard lines that was there but I bought them a little longer so I could run them under everything. I'll take pics so I can better explain. I don't have kpro yet but no check light so far
